How the Medication Helps: The Mechanism of Action

The efficacy of Clotrimazole lies in its precise biochemical mechanism. As an imidazole derivative, Clotrimazole works by interfering with the synthesis of ergosterol, a vital component of the fungal cell membrane. Without ergosterol, the fungal cell membrane loses its structural integrity, leading to increased permeability, leakage of essential cellular components, and ultimately, the death of the fungal cell. This targeted action means that Clotrimazole effectively stops fungal growth (fungistatic) and, at higher concentrations, actively kills the fungus (fungicidal).

This mechanism is highly specific to fungal cells, which utilize ergosterol, rather than human cells, which use cholesterol in their membranes. This specificity is key to the medication's relatively favorable safety profile when used as directed. When applied topically, Clotrimazole penetrates the skin layers where the fungi reside, concentrating its action precisely where it is needed most. This direct assault on the fungal cell structure provides a reliable path to clearing the infection, unlike some oral medications which have broader systemic effects. General Information: Understanding the Active Ingredient and Category

Clotrimazole belongs to the azole class of antifungal medications. Chemically, it is a synthetic imidazole derivative. Its categorization is firmly within the Anti Fungal therapeutic group. The active ingredient concentration in topical preparations is typically standardized, ensuring potency across different brands. We are focusing here on the topical preparation, often available in a 15g size, which is ideal for treating localized patches of infection on the skin.

It is important to differentiate Clotrimazole from other antifungal classes. For instance, allylamines like Lamisil (Terbinafine) operate via a different pathway, inhibiting squalene epoxidase. While both are highly effective, individual response can vary. Similarly, older systemic treatments like Grifulvin (Griseofulvin) are reserved for more severe or resistant infections affecting hair, skin, and nails, necessitating oral intake. Clotrimazole offers a highly effective frontline topical defense against common superficial mycoses. Available Forms and Dosages of Clotrimazole

While the focus here is on the topical formulation, it is helpful to know the versatility of Clotrimazole. It is primarily used topically in concentrations ranging from 1% to 2% solutions or creams. The 15g topical dosage size is extremely practical for treating small to moderate areas of the body affected by athlete's foot, ringworm, or cutaneous candidiasis. For vaginal candidiasis, it is available in higher-dose creams, ovules, or vaginal tablets.

The standard application for topical fungal infections typically involves applying the cream thinly to the affected area and the surrounding skin twice daily for a period usually lasting two to four weeks, depending on the severity and type of infection. Adhering strictly to the prescribed or recommended duration is vital, even if symptoms clear up quickly, to ensure the complete eradication of fungal spores. How to Use Clotrimazole Safely and Effectively

Proper application technique maximizes the effectiveness of Clotrimazole. Before applying the cream, the affected area must be gently washed and thoroughly dried. Moisture retention is the fungus's friend; ensuring the skin is dry prevents immediate recontamination and allows the active ingredient to penetrate unimpeded. Apply a thin layer of the 15g cream gently onto the infected area and about an inch of the surrounding healthy skin.

It is crucial to remember that you are treating the entire area where the fungus might be spreading, not just the visible rash center. Wash your hands thoroughly after application unless the infection is on your hands. For external use only, avoid contact with eyes or mucous membranes unless specifically instructed by a physician. If you are treating a vaginal yeast infection with the suppository form, follow the package instructions precisely regarding insertion time, often at bedtime. Safety and Side Effects Profile

Clotrimazole is generally very well tolerated when used topically as directed. Because it acts locally, systemic absorption is minimal, leading to a low incidence of severe side effects. The most common side effects are localized skin reactions at the application site. These may include mild burning, itching, redness, stinging, or a slight peeling sensation. These minor irritations often subside as the skin adjusts to the medication.

In rare cases, a patient might experience an allergic reaction, characterized by severe rash, swelling, or difficulty breathing—this requires immediate medical attention. It is important to distinguish between these rare allergic reactions and the mild, transient irritation common with many topical antifungals. Unlike some broader-spectrum oral agents, which carry risks related to liver function (such as those sometimes associated with Ketoconazole treatments), topical Clotrimazole avoids these systemic concerns. FAQ Section

Q: Can I use Clotrimazole if I am pregnant or breastfeeding?

A: While topical Clotrimazole is generally considered low risk due to minimal systemic absorption, p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should always consult their obstetrician or primary care provider before starting any medication, including over-the-counter treatments. They can weigh the benefits against any theoretical risks.

Q: Is Clotrimazole effective against toenail fungus?

A: Topical Clotrimazole is generally not the first-line treatment for established toenail fungus (onychomycosis) because it struggles to penetrate the hard nail plate effectively. For toenail fungus, oral medications like Terbinafine or stronger topical prescriptions are usually required. However, it can be very effective for the skin surrounding the nail or for mild superficial nail involvement. Q: What should I do if my rash gets worse after starting Clotrimazole?

A: If the redness, burning, or swelling intensifies significantly after a few days of use, stop applying the cream immediately and contact your healthcare provider. This could indicate irritation or a true allergic reaction, rather than the infection worsening. If you are experiencing severe symptoms, seek immediate care.

Q: How does Clotrimazole compare to older antifungals like Grisactin?

A: Griseofulvin (Grisactin) is an older, systemic (oral) antifungal primarily used for widespread or resistant infections of the hair, skin, and nails, requiring a longer course and carrying more potential for systemic side effects. Clotrimazole is a modern, highly targeted topical agent best suited for localized, superficial infections, offering a much safer profile for everyday use.
